Abstract :
As grid technologies evolve quickly on Internet, research related to resource scheduling faces new opportunities and challenges. These new technologies, ideas and approaches provide a new environment for researching and developing the economy-based resource scheduling system. Aiming at the hierarchical grid model, following load balancing thinking and cost-time optimization strategies, this paper proposes a new grid resource scheduling algorithm, which can not only increase the utilization of resources and system throughput, but also realize the load balancing and utility optimization between resource providers and users within grid systems. On the basis of having described the different functional parts of the proposed algorithm, two kinds of simulative experiments about completion time and cost of tasks are conducted. Finally, the experiment results show that the proposed algorithm is effective.
